蒲公英 - 制药技术的传播者 GMP理论的实践者

搜索
楼主: zlanylz
收起左侧

Excel中四舍六入五留双完美版~~

  [复制链接]
药徒
发表于 2019-2-26 19:32:03 | 显示全部楼层
谢谢楼主分享
回复

使用道具 举报

药徒
发表于 2019-2-26 22:51:49 来自手机 | 显示全部楼层
有才的网友就是你,赞一个
回复

使用道具 举报

发表于 2019-2-28 21:24:41 | 显示全部楼层
数据有三个以上的小数位数,如要取两个小数点修约自行写了个excel公式:=IF(MID(A1-INT(A1),5,1)/1<=5,MID(A1-INT(A1),1,4)+INT(A1)+MOD(MID(A1-INT(A1),4,1),2)/100,IF(MID(A1-INT(A1),5,1)/1>5,MID(A1-INT(A1),1,4)+INT(A1)+0.01))
回复

使用道具 举报

药徒
发表于 2019-3-1 09:17:30 | 显示全部楼层
使用后如何做确认,谢谢
回复

使用道具 举报

药徒
 楼主| 发表于 2019-3-1 09:40:53 | 显示全部楼层
李光耀 发表于 2019-3-1 09:17
使用后如何做确认,谢谢

对不起~~~我们私下用,做不了~~~
回复

使用道具 举报

药生
发表于 2019-3-1 09:49:46 | 显示全部楼层
如此高大上,先学习吧
回复

使用道具 举报

发表于 2019-3-5 15:16:58 | 显示全部楼层
感谢分享!
回复

使用道具 举报

药徒
发表于 2019-3-12 23:52:47 来自手机 | 显示全部楼层
下载不了,扣了几次金币了
回复

使用道具 举报

药徒
 楼主| 发表于 2019-3-18 10:34:50 | 显示全部楼层
PGYdzl 发表于 2019-3-12 23:52
下载不了,扣了几次金币了

百度云链接:https://pan.baidu.com/s/1kpYFN5q3Ql7OCn1YqOcI7Q
提取码:uy2f
回复

使用道具 举报

药徒
发表于 2019-3-18 15:40:37 | 显示全部楼层
这个不错,留着备用
回复

使用道具 举报

发表于 2019-3-19 08:17:20 | 显示全部楼层
厉害厉害,谢谢分享
回复

使用道具 举报

药徒
发表于 2019-7-30 08:49:17 | 显示全部楼层
学习学习了
回复

使用道具 举报

药徒
 楼主| 发表于 2019-7-30 13:16:11 | 显示全部楼层
本帖最后由 zlanylz 于 2019-7-30 13:18 编辑

四舍六入五留双公式版~~大家EXCEL应该可以验证了吧~~
当且仅当修约位数的数字为偶数,并且后面一位小数值为5,并且5后面没有没有任何数字时才不进位。因此我们只需要用excel的IF函数判断是否为这种情况,不是这种情况按照默认的四舍五入正常修约即可满足四舍六入五成双的规则。
这里我们可以用MOD函数结合POWER函数实现,也就是只需要判断公式  "abs(mod(修约小数*POWER(10,修约位数), 2)  )=0.5"是否为真,为真则舍去5,为假时则正常修约,舍去不要的小数可以用rounddown函数实现。
只需要用IF函数判断步骤2里面的公式是否为真即可,完整的公式为:"if(abs(mod(修约小数*POWER(10,修约位数),  2) )=0.5, rounddown(修约小数,修约位数), round(修约小数,修约位数。
公式的关键就在于判断条件是否为真,为真时不进位,用rounddown实现;为假时正常修约。
‘=IF(ABS(MOD(A2*POWER(10,B2),2))=0.5,ROUNDDOWN(A2,B2),ROUND(A2,B2))

四舍六入五留双(公式版).xlsx

11.05 KB, 下载次数: 130

点评

输入12.005和8.005,答案就不一样,一个是12.00,一个是8.01  详情 回复 发表于 2025-1-10 15:46
回复

使用道具 举报

发表于 2021-11-17 13:04:05 | 显示全部楼层
感谢分享,非常有用
回复

使用道具 举报

药徒
发表于 2021-11-17 13:20:34 | 显示全部楼层
这个举例比好多资料的举例看的明白
回复

使用道具 举报

药徒
发表于 2021-11-17 15:13:56 | 显示全部楼层
这要费多少脑细胞,辛苦辛苦,谢谢
回复

使用道具 举报

发表于 2021-12-6 22:50:52 来自手机 | 显示全部楼层
回复

使用道具 举报

药徒
发表于 2022-5-14 21:47:40 | 显示全部楼层

谢谢楼主分享
回复

使用道具 举报

药生
发表于 2022-5-16 15:50:18 | 显示全部楼层
可以体现吗?怎么做确认
回复

使用道具 举报

发表于 2022-5-23 10:48:18 | 显示全部楼层
=TRUNC(ROUND(E106,3+(ROUND(MOD(E106*10^3,2),9)=0.5)),3)

点评

试着可以用  详情 回复 发表于 2022-5-23 14:43
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

×发帖声明
1、本站为技术交流论坛,发帖的内容具有互动属性。您在本站发布的内容:
①在无人回复的情况下,可以通过自助删帖功能随时删除(自助删帖功能关闭期间,可以联系管理员微信:8542508 处理。)
②在有人回复和讨论的情况下,主题帖和回复内容已构成一个不可分割的整体,您将不能直接删除该帖。
2、禁止发布任何涉政、涉黄赌毒及其他违反国家相关法律、法规、及本站版规的内容,详情请参阅《蒲公英论坛总版规》。
3、您在本站发表、转载的任何作品仅代表您个人观点,不代表本站观点。不要盗用有版权要求的作品,转贴请注明来源,否则文责自负。
4、请认真阅读上述条款,您发帖即代表接受上述条款。

QQ|手机版|蒲公英|ouryao|蒲公英 ( 京ICP备14042168号-1 )  增值电信业务经营许可证编号:京B2-20243455  互联网药品信息服务资格证书编号:(京)-非经营性-2024-0033

GMT+8, 2025-4-4 18:01

Powered by Discuz! X3.4运维单位:苏州豚鼠科技有限公司

Copyright © 2001-2020, Tencent Cloud.

声明:蒲公英网站所涉及的原创文章、文字内容、视频图片及首发资料,版权归作者及蒲公英网站所有,转载要在显著位置标明来源“蒲公英”;禁止任何形式的商业用途。违反上述声明的,本站及作者将追究法律责任。
快速回复 返回顶部 返回列表